性能瓶颈

  • Composer的–apcu-autoloader选项如何提升性能?

    APCU是一种PHP用户级数据缓存扩展,通过共享内存存储数组、配置等变量数据,Composer的–apcu-autoloader选项利用APCU缓存自动加载映射,避免每次请求重复解析autoload文件和执行文件I/O,在生产环境中显著减少类查找开销,提升自动加载速度,降低CPU与磁盘负…

    2025年11月29日
    000
  • Python中嵌套循环的替代方案:使用Numba加速计算

    Python中嵌套循环的替代方案:使用Numba加速计算Python中嵌套循环的替代方案:使用Numba加速计算Python中嵌套循环的替代方案:使用Numba加速计算Python中嵌套循环的替代方案:使用Numba加速计算

    本文旨在提供一种优化Python中嵌套循环计算效率的方法,特别是针对计算密集型任务。通过使用Numba库的即时编译(JIT)技术,可以显著提升代码的执行速度,避免传统嵌套循环带来的性能瓶颈。文章将展示如何使用Numba加速原始代码,并提供并行化的优化方案,以及性能对比。 在Python中,嵌套循环是…

    2025年11月29日 用户投稿
    200
  • 从SQL到Python:Pandas与SQL实现数据高效转置的策略

    从SQL到Python:Pandas与SQL实现数据高效转置的策略从SQL到Python:Pandas与SQL实现数据高效转置的策略从SQL到Python:Pandas与SQL实现数据高效转置的策略从SQL到Python:Pandas与SQL实现数据高效转置的策略

    本文探讨了如何高效地将sql数据库中的长格式数据重构为python中的宽格式列表。针对常见的数据转置需求,文章详细介绍了两种主要策略:首先,通过pandas的`query`结合`pivot`或`set_index`/`unstack`函数进行优化,实现python层面的高效处理;其次,提出将数据转置…

    2025年11月29日 用户投稿
    000
  • 蒙特卡洛模拟优化批量检测策略:寻找最佳批次大小

    蒙特卡洛模拟优化批量检测策略:寻找最佳批次大小蒙特卡洛模拟优化批量检测策略:寻找最佳批次大小蒙特卡洛模拟优化批量检测策略:寻找最佳批次大小蒙特卡洛模拟优化批量检测策略:寻找最佳批次大小

    本文探讨如何利用蒙特卡洛模拟为疾病批量检测确定最优批次大小。通过分析初始模拟方法的缺陷,文章详细介绍了正确的批量检测逻辑实现,并利用numpy进行性能优化,大幅提升了模拟效率。此外,还提供了针对大规模数据集的并行化策略,旨在帮助读者高效、准确地找到在不同感染概率下最小化总检测次数的最佳批次大小。 引…

    2025年11月29日 用户投稿
    000
  • 优化大规模细胞突变模拟:使用Numba提升Python性能

    优化大规模细胞突变模拟:使用Numba提升Python性能优化大规模细胞突变模拟:使用Numba提升Python性能优化大规模细胞突变模拟:使用Numba提升Python性能优化大规模细胞突变模拟:使用Numba提升Python性能

    本文探讨了在大规模细胞突变模拟中,使用标准numpy操作时遇到的性能瓶颈,尤其是在处理指数级增长的细胞数量时。通过分析随机数生成、内存访问和数组操作的效率问题,文章提出并演示了如何利用numba进行即时编译和优化随机数生成策略,从而显著提升模拟速度和资源利用率,为生物计算领域的大规模数据处理提供高效…

    2025年11月29日 用户投稿
    000
  • SQL条件计数COUNTIF怎么实现_SQL条件计数聚合方法

    SQL条件计数COUNTIF怎么实现_SQL条件计数聚合方法SQL条件计数COUNTIF怎么实现_SQL条件计数聚合方法SQL条件计数COUNTIF怎么实现_SQL条件计数聚合方法SQL条件计数COUNTIF怎么实现_SQL条件计数聚合方法

    答案:SQL中通过SUM结合CASE实现条件计数,如统计订单状态为“已完成”的数量,可扩展至复杂条件、唯一值统计及性能优化。 在SQL里,我们并没有一个像Excel那样直观的 COUNTIF 函数。但要实现条件计数,核心思路其实非常直接:利用 SUM 聚合函数,结合 CASE 表达式来构造一个条件判…

    2025年11月29日 用户投稿
    000
  • SQL函数使用导致性能问题怎么办_函数使用优化指南

    SQL函数使用导致性能问题怎么办_函数使用优化指南SQL函数使用导致性能问题怎么办_函数使用优化指南SQL函数使用导致性能问题怎么办_函数使用优化指南SQL函数使用导致性能问题怎么办_函数使用优化指南

    SQL函数在查询中的不当使用确实是性能杀手,这几乎是每个开发者或DBA都会遇到的头疼事。简单来说,解决这类问题核心思路就是:尽可能让数据库优化器能“看懂”你的意图,避免它在黑暗中摸索,或者干脆绕开那些让它“看不懂”的函数。 这通常意味着你需要重写查询,或者用一些巧妙的数据库特性来辅助。 解决方案 当…

    2025年11月29日 用户投稿
    000
  • 查询结果集过大如何优化_减少网络传输的结果集分页策略

    查询结果集过大如何优化_减少网络传输的结果集分页策略查询结果集过大如何优化_减少网络传输的结果集分页策略查询结果集过大如何优化_减少网络传输的结果集分页策略查询结果集过大如何优化_减少网络传输的结果集分页策略

    最核心的优化策略是实施分页,通过LIMIT和OFFSET实现简单但深分页性能差,应优先采用基于游标(如WHERE id > last_id)的分页方式以避免扫描跳过大量数据,结合索引优化、减少SELECT *、使用缓存及混合策略来提升性能。 当面对查询结果集庞大到足以拖慢网络传输和服务器响应时…

    2025年11月29日 用户投稿
    100
  • SQL中如何使用子查询_SQL子查询的写法与应用

    SQL中如何使用子查询_SQL子查询的写法与应用SQL中如何使用子查询_SQL子查询的写法与应用SQL中如何使用子查询_SQL子查询的写法与应用SQL中如何使用子查询_SQL子查询的写法与应用

    子查询是将一个SELECT语句嵌入另一个查询中,可在WHERE、SELECT、FROM、HAVING子句中使用,常用于条件筛选、计算聚合值或构建派生表;例如用IN配合子查询查找美国客户的订单:SELECT OrderID, CustomerID, Amount FROM Orders WHERE C…

    2025年11月29日 用户投稿
    000
  • SQL查询速度慢怎么办_SQL查询优化技巧详解

    SQL查询速度慢怎么办_SQL查询优化技巧详解SQL查询速度慢怎么办_SQL查询优化技巧详解SQL查询速度慢怎么办_SQL查询优化技巧详解SQL查询速度慢怎么办_SQL查询优化技巧详解

    答案是通过合理使用索引、优化SQL语句、调整数据库设计和服务器配置来提升SQL查询性能。具体包括:利用EXPLAIN分析执行计划,创建复合索引并遵循最左匹配原则,使用覆盖索引减少回表;避免在索引列上进行函数操作或类型转换,防止索引失效;SELECT只取必要字段,优化JOIN条件确保索引使用,优先采用…

    2025年11月29日 用户投稿
    100
关注微信